Markit: Russia’s Manufacturing PMI rises to 52.1 in January
MOSCOW, Feb 1 (PRIME) -- Russia’s Manufacturing Purchasing Managers' Index (PMI) grew to 52.1 in January from 52 in December, researcher IHS Markit said in a statement on Thursday.
The index remained above the 50 no-change mark which indicates an overall expansion of the sector.
“Production growth across the Russian manufacturing sector continued to accelerate in January, and was the strongest since July 2017. The overall improvement in business conditions was also supported by a faster upturn in new orders. The latest survey data signaled a solid start to the year, with IHS Markit currently forecasting a 1.7% rise in industrial production in 2018,” Sian Jones, economist at IHS Markit, said as cited in the statement.
